The Wyoming Real Estate Commission sits at 2617 E. Lincolnway, Suite H, Cheyenne, WY 82002. Phone (307) 777-7141. Email realestatecommission@wyo.gov. Fax (307) 777-3796. Statute: W.S. 33-28-101 through 33-28-401. Pearson VUE delivers the exam under Candidate Handbook #095100 (July 2024, rev 04/2025) at pearsonvue.com/us/en/wy/realestate.html, (866) 600-5442. The credential name is the first trap. Wyoming still says salesperson. Colorado does not. South Dakota does not. Entry is Salesperson I + Salesperson II + Wyoming Law from a Commission-listed provider — the live obtain-a-license page fetched 2026-09-02 does not print a combined clock-hour total, so this hub will not freeze 80 from a blog. Out-of-state active licensees skip Salesperson I, take Law + II, and sit the Wyoming state paper. Colorado FA licensees are salespersons here; EA/IA/ER/EI/IR/II are brokers here.

Pearson seats 80 national items in 2.5 hours and 40 Wyoming-law items in 1.5 hours at a scaled 75, $80 at a center / $90 OnVUE per portion, both parts (or the failed part) inside six months of the first pass. Apply within 90 days of the later pass with $300, two fingerprint cards + $39 payable to the Attorney General, E&O, photo, and license histories. Chapter 2 also prints a $20 Recovery and Education Fund assessment. Walk-ins do not exist. Fingerprints are step 1 on the Commission’s own list, not a leftover IdentoGO packet.

Associate broker is two of the last four years plus named Broker I / II / Law. Responsible broker adds Wyoming Broker Management (handbook: 8 hours within one year of filing), a Wyoming trust account or funds-holder agreement, and Consent to Examine and Audit. Broker state paper is 50 scored items. Renewal is three years, $350, 45-hour CE for salespersons and associate brokers, 53 hours including 8 Broker Management for responsible brokers. Inactive still renews ($370 on the live CE page) or cancels. Utah’s IdentoGO, Colorado’s 168, and Montana’s 70-hour Pearson $95 sitting are neighbor comparisons, not Wyoming’s thesis.
